Public Employees Federation Endorses Barrie for Schenectady County Legislature

ALBANY, NY (10/30/2009)(readMedia)-- The New York State Public Employees Federation (PEF) is pleased to announce its endorsement of PEF Member Mary Barrie, running for the Schenectady County Legislature in District 4, which includes the communities of Rotterdam, Duanesburg and Princetown.

"We are endorsing Mary Barrie because of her exerience and her record of independent and responsible activism and community leadership," said William Wurster, PEF's regional coordinator for the greater Capital District. "She has demonstrated a strong ability to think and act constructively on the important issues facing her community and the County Legislature."

Barrie is an environmental program specialist for the state Department of Environmental Conservation and received the endorsement of the League of Conservation Voter for her leadership on environmental and conservation issues. Barrie co-chaired the Rotterdam Conservation Advisory Council, crafting an ordinance for erosion and sediment control to complement the Storm Water Management Program, the first in the county. She also advocated for legislation to protect the Great Flats Aquifer and similar potable water supplies in other watersheds of NYS. Currently, she is developing landmark and historic preservation opportunities in the Town of Rotterdam.

PEF is the state's second-largest state-employee union, representing 59,000 professional, scientific and technical employees.
